6 Foods to Avoid if You Have Fatty Liver Disease and 5 Best Foods for Fatty Liver Disease

Posted on March 26, 2026 by Admin

Fatty liver disease (non-alcoholic fatty liver disease, NAFLD) can often be managed or improved through diet. Certain foods worsen liver fat accumulation, while others support liver health. Here’s a clear breakdown:


🚫 6 Foods to Avoid with Fatty Liver Disease

  1. Sugary Foods and Drinks
    • Includes soda, candy, pastries, and sweetened cereals.
    • High fructose intake promotes fat buildup in the liver.
  2. Refined Carbohydrates
    • White bread, white rice, pasta, and baked goods made with white flour.
    • Cause spikes in blood sugar and insulin, which worsen liver fat.
  3. Fried and Fast Foods
    • High in trans fats and saturated fats.
    • Contribute to inflammation and liver fat accumulation.
  4. Alcohol
    • Even moderate alcohol can accelerate liver damage in fatty liver disease.
    • Best avoided entirely if you have NAFLD.
  5. Red and Processed Meats
    • Bacon, sausages, hot dogs, and fatty cuts of beef or pork.
    • High in saturated fats and chemicals that increase liver fat and inflammation.
  6. Full-Fat Dairy Products
    • Whole milk, cream, butter, and full-fat cheese.
    • High in saturated fats, which can worsen insulin resistance and liver fat.

✅ 5 Best Foods for Fatty Liver Disease

  1. Leafy Greens and Cruciferous Vegetables
    • Spinach, kale, broccoli, cauliflower.
    • Rich in antioxidants and fiber to reduce liver fat and inflammation.
  2. Fatty Fish (Omega-3 Rich)
    • Salmon, sardines, mackerel.
    • Omega-3 fatty acids improve liver fat and reduce inflammation.
  3. Whole Grains
    • Oats, quinoa, brown rice, barley.
    • Provide fiber and stabilize blood sugar, supporting liver health.
  4. Nuts
    • Almonds, walnuts, pistachios.
    • Contain healthy fats and antioxidants that reduce liver fat.
  5. Fruits Low in Sugar
    • Berries, apples, oranges.
    • High in antioxidants and fiber, supporting liver detoxification and metabolism.

💡 Extra Tips for Fatty Liver

  • Exercise regularly: Even brisk walking 30 minutes/day helps reduce liver fat.
  • Stay hydrated: Water supports liver detoxification.
  • Portion control: Focus on balanced meals with lean protein, healthy fats, and fiber-rich carbs.
